The latest set of IMPACT Wrestling tapings went down over this weekend - Friday, 21 and Saturday, 22 January - in Fort Lauderdale, Florida, and saw returns from Blake Christian, Santana Garrett and Kenny King, amongst others, a new Digital Media Champion crowned in Matt Cardona, and the debut of IMPACT's teased new knockout, Gisele Shaw.

Twitter user @MrJacobCohen was in attendance for both nights of the tapings, and published full results as they happened. Given that one of the segments taped has been advertised for this coming Thursday's broadcast of IMPACT Wrestling, expect these tapings to last IMPACT all the way through to No Surrender on 19 February.

Here's a rundown of the two nights:-

21 January

Eddie Edwards d. Big Kon (taped for Before The IMPACT).

Laredo Kid d. Blake Christian (taped for Before The IMPACT).

Jake Something d. Chris Bey. Mike Bailey saved Jake from a Guerrillas of Destiny beatdown post-match, before Jay White returned to help lay out both.

Honor No More were in the crowd, confronted by an IMPACT quintet of Josh Alexander, Chris Sabin, Eddie Edwards, Rich Swann, and Rhino. Scott D'Amore made a five-on-five bout for No Surrender, where Honor No More can stay if they win, but lose if they leave.

Mickie James addressed the entire knockouts division, referencing how much history they'd made recently, before promising to win the women's Royal Rumble match, and defending the Knockouts World Championship at WrestleMania 38.

Handicap Match: W. Morrissey d. The Learning Tree

JONAH d. Johnny Swinger. Decay checked on Swinger afterwards, with Black Taurus having a staredown with JONAH.

PCO d. Chris Sabin. Team IMPACT ran off Honor No More post-match.

Digital Media Championship: Matt Cardona d. Jordynne Grace to become the new champion.

Jonathan Gresham d. Steve Maclin by disqualification when Maclin refused to break on a rope break. Gresham was saved by Honor No More, but left them standing. Ian Riccaboni, Bobby Cruise and Cary Silkin were in attendance.

Josh Alexander d. Vinny. Kenny King returned to IMPACT post-match as Honor No More's newest member.

Bhupinder Gujjar d. John Skyler.

Masha Slamovich d. Kaci Lennox.

Deonna Purrazzo d. Santana Garrett.

Mickie James vs. Chelsea Green ended in a disqualification when Tasha Steelz and Savannah Evans got involved.

Bullet Club's Jay White, Chris Bey, and the Guerrillas of Destiny d. Ace Austin, Madman Fulton, Jake Something, and Mike Bailey. Bullet Club were attacked after by Violent By Design and the Good Brothers.

22 January

Jack Talos d. VSK (possible dark match).

Lady Frost d. Alisha Edwards (taped for Before The IMPACT). Gisele Shaw debuted after the match, posing in front of Lady Frost.

Black Taurus d. Raj Singh (taped for Before The IMPACT).

The IInspiration d. The Influence's Madison Rayne and Kaleb With A K.

Josh Alexander explains how grateful he is for IMPACT Wrestling taking a chance on him. He wants to go to war with Honor No More, and then challenge for the World Championship post-No Surrender. Big Kon confronts him.

Josh Alexander d. Big Kon. The Walking Weapon lays his hands on security and Scott D'Amore post-match, resulting in D'Amore removing Alexander from the No Surrender card and sending him home.

There was a long promo between Bullet Club, Violent By Design, and the Good Brothers. It set up VBD vs. Jay White and the Guerrillas of Destiny for these tapings, as well as Eric Young vs. White, and the Good Brothers vs. G.O.D for No Surrender.

Honor No More's Matt Taven and Mike Bennett d. Rhino and Rich Swann after Maria Kanellis-Bennett blinded Rhino with powder. Steve Maclin saved Team IMPACT after the match.

No Disqualifications Match: W. Morrissey d. Brian Myers. Moose attacked Morrissey with a chair post-match.

JONAH d. Crazzy Steve. JONAH and Black Taurus stood off again after the match.

Masha Slamovich d. Kiah Dream.

Ace Austin d. Laredo Kid and Blake Christian.

Gisele Shaw d. Lady Frost.

Chris Sabin d. Kenny King. Ian Riccaboni was on commentary for the bout.

Tasha Steelz and Savannah Evans d. Mickie James and Chelsea Green.

Moose signs the contract for his World Championship match at No Surrender. W. Morrissey ultimately shows up to chokeslam Moose off the stage.

Bullet Club's Jay White and the Guerrillas of Destiny d. Violent By Design after White pinned Deaner.
